Arms - agkale

arms

Definition: enagkalizomai (en-ang-kal-id'-zom-ahee) Verb - to take into one's arms - from the preposition en (in), and the noun agkale (agkalé) - the curve or inner angle of the bent arm.

Definition: agkalé (ang-kal'-ay) Noun, Feminine - an Arm

Diagram: The Sign of an "arm" are the three vesicas inside the white circles in the above diagram.

Mk 09:36 And into his bent arms a child, he stands it in their midst.
Mk 10:16 And them into his bent arms, he is down-blessing, placing hands on them.
